LOCATION
Austin is the gateway to the Texas Hill Country, with rolling hills, sparkling waterways, and fascinating geology. This historic city commonly ranks on top 10 lists of best places to live and visit and is known for being the Live Music Capital of the World® with nearly 200 live music venues. The meeting is located on campus, but close to downtown, and is hosted by one of the largest academic geoscience communities in the world.
The theme of the meeting is Celebrating Advances in Geoscience: Our Science, Our Societal Impact, and Our Unique Thought Processes. The meeting will take a look at how far we have come as a result of scientific and technological advances in the last 50 years as well as predictions for future advances.
